essential information
It is a colorless, transparent, low viscosity volatile liquid with a special odor and an organic ether with an oxygen content of 18.2%. Its steam is heavier than air, can diffuse along the ground, and can burn when coexisting with strong oxidants.
application area
Used as a gasoline additive to increase octane rating, it can also be cracked to produce isobutene, which has excellent anti knock properties and can be used as a gasoline additive. It has good miscibility with gasoline, low water absorption, and no pollution to the environment. As an organic synthesis raw material, high-purity isobutene can be produced.
Packaging, Storage, Transportation, and Safety
Emergency response to leakage
Quickly evacuate personnel from the contaminated area to a safe zone, isolate them, and strictly restrict their entry and exit. Cut off the fire source. It is recommended that emergency responders wear self-contained positive pressure respirators and firefighting protective clothing. Cut off the leakage source as much as possible to prevent it from entering restricted spaces such as sewers and drainage ditches. Minor leakage: Absorb with sand, vermiculite, or other inert materials. Massive leakage: constructing embankments or digging pits for containment; Cover with foam to reduce steam disaster. Transfer to a tanker or dedicated collector using an explosion-proof pump, and recycle or transport to a waste disposal site for disposal.
Protective measures
Respiratory protection: When there is a possibility of exposure to its vapors, wear a filtered gas mask (half face mask).
Eye protection: Wear chemical safety goggles.
Body protection: Wear anti-static work clothes.
Hand protection: Wear rubber gloves.
Other: Smoking is strictly prohibited at the work site. After work, take a shower and change clothes.
Emergency measures
Skin contact: Remove contaminated clothing and thoroughly rinse the skin with soap and water.
Eye contact: Lift the eyelids and rinse with flowing water or saline solution. Seek medical attention.
Inhalation: Quickly leave the scene and move to a place with fresh air. Keep the respiratory tract unobstructed. If breathing is difficult, administer oxygen. If breathing stops, immediately perform artificial respiration. Seek medical attention.
Ingestion: Drink plenty of warm water, do not induce vomiting, seek medical attention.
